The GTMedia V8 Nova remains one of the most popular budget-friendly multi-stream satellite receivers on the market, praised for its ability to handle DVB-S2, T2-MI, and various encryption protocols. On , the manufacturer released a significant firmware update (often labeled GTMedia_V8_Nova_Release_20181025.bin ). If the receiver rejects the file, verify that the USB is strictly formatted to FAT32. If the issue persists, the downloaded file may be corrupted; re-download the firmware from a verified mirror and compare hashes if available.
